Sketchode is a free vector graphics and UI/UX design software. It provides a clean and intuitive interface for creating logos, icons, website mockups, mobile app designs, illustrations, and more. Key features include a vast library of templates, reusable symbols and styles, and tools for prototyping and collaboration.
Zeplin is a collaboration tool for UI/UX designers and developers. It allows designers to create styleguides and design specs, and developers can inspect designs and export assets. Useful for improving communication and streamlining handoff between teams.
